Lula Optimistic About US-Brazil Trade Deal After Trump Talks
UPDATE: Brazilian President Luiz Inácio Lula da Silva expressed strong optimism today regarding a potential trade deal with the United States following a productive meeting with President Donald Trump in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ia. Lula revealed that Trump practically “guaranteed” progress on the negotiations during their discussions on July 15, 2023, held at a regional summit.
During a news conference earlier today, Lula described the meeting as “very good,” affirming that he presented Trump with a document outlining Brazil’s stance against recent 40% tariffs imposed by the U.S. He emphasized that the tariffs, put in place due to claims of an economic emergency linked to Brazil’s former president, Jair Bolsonaro, were based on “mistaken information.”
Trump indicated a willingness to reconsider the tariffs, stating, “I think we should be able to make some good deals for both countries.” Lula reiterated that Brazil is one of only three nations in the Group of 20 with which the U.S. maintains a trade surplus, reporting a significant $6.8 billion trade surplus last year.
Lula urged that Bolsonaro’s legal troubles should not impact their trade discussions, saying, “Bolsonaro is part of the past now in Brazilian history.” This assertion highlights Lula’s attempt to shift focus away from Bolsonaro’s recent conviction related to an attempted coup.
In addition to trade discussions, Lula extended an offer to assist in mediating the ongoing crisis in Venezuela, where President Nicolas Maduro has accused the U.S. of aggression. Lula, who celebrated his 80th birthday today, expressed optimism about his legacy and future, stating, “I hope to live up to 120 years old.”
As the situation develops, Lula remains confident that a resolution will be reached in the coming days. The outcome of these negotiations could have significant implications for both nations, especially as they navigate complex economic and diplomatic landscapes.
